I covered the UNC-Arizona game, and Carolina looked good in a game they had to look good in.

The Heels shot over 56 percent. They also won the battle of the boards by eight and kept their turnovers to just 13, which was a key for them.

Having lost three of their last four, Carolina needed this one --- at home on national televsion against a team with talent. Although Arizona played tired, and of course, they are a West Coast team and the 1 p.m. start to them was really 10 a.m.

Where would Carolina be without Tyler Hansbrough? (Probably the NIT) The kid battles and plays with intensity all the time. He makes the others better -- Arizona crowded him, and it opened up things for Wes Miller and Danny Green. You may wonder why Wes Miller is interviewed a lot -- he's a great talker, which helps us all out.

Anyway, a good day for Carolina. Lucky for the Heels that the ACC as a whole is down, because they have a great shot to make the NCAA's. Still though, Hansbrough needs help underneath, and if the outside shots don't fall, they're in trouble.

Still, in a watered-down league, in my mind, Carolina's behind Duke and State (despite their win over the 'Pack) and Boston College, and their chances after that are about as good as anybody else's. we'll see.
